java.lang.Object
jakarta.mail.search.SearchTerm
jakarta.mail.search.ComparisonTerm
- All Implemented Interfaces:
Serializable
- Direct Known Subclasses:
DateTerm
,IntegerComparisonTerm
This class models the comparison operator. This is an abstract
class; subclasses implement comparisons for different datatypes.
- See Also:
-
Field Summary
Modifier and TypeFieldDescriptionprotected int
The comparison.static final int
Equal to, "=
", comparison.static final int
Greater than or equal to, ">=
", comparison.static final int
Greater than, ">
", comparison.static final int
Less than or equal to, "<=
", comparison.static final int
Less than, "<
", comparison.static final int
Not equal to, "!=
", comparison. -
Constructor Summary
-
Method Summary
Methods inherited from class jakarta.mail.search.SearchTerm
match
-
Field Details
-
LE
public static final int LELess than or equal to, "<=
", comparison.- See Also:
-
LT
public static final int LTLess than, "<
", comparison.- See Also:
-
EQ
public static final int EQEqual to, "=
", comparison.- See Also:
-
NE
public static final int NENot equal to, "!=
", comparison.- See Also:
-
GT
public static final int GTGreater than, ">
", comparison.- See Also:
-
GE
public static final int GEGreater than or equal to, ">=
", comparison.- See Also:
-
comparison
protected int comparisonThe comparison.
-
-
Constructor Details
-
ComparisonTerm
public ComparisonTerm()Creates a defaultComparisonTerm
.- See Also:
-
-
Method Details
-
equals
-
hashCode
-